Variety: Chardonnay • Region: Kamptal • Vineyard: Various estate sites • Soil Type: Various but chalk heavy • Fermentation & Élevage: Stainless steel fermentation, aging in 300L and 2500L Austrian oak • Farming: Certified Organic

The Chardonnay grapes for the Blanc de Blancs were harvested in September from various vineyard sites of the wine estate, mainly those on southeast slopes with calcareous soils. The acidity and maturity of the grapes were at the exact point of readiness when they were picked and placed in small crates and then pressed very gently in the cellar. Fermentation took place in stainless steel tanks, where also the malolactic fermentation occurred as well. After this, the still wine, together with the fine yeast (about 10% of the total yeast), was racked into used Austrian oak barrels (2-3 years old; 300 liters or 2.500 liters). The following year, the base wine was filled into bottles; in these, the second fermentation took place with the help of sugar and yeast. The young sparkling wine stayed in contact with the yeast for at least 36 months before undergoing remuage (riddling) and, finally, dégorgement (disgorging) in our cellars.

"A sensational sparkling chardonnay with fantastic racy energy, leesy complexity and terrific minerality. Seashells and rock pools. The fine mousse interlocks with this beautifully and transports you in the direction of blanc de blancs nirvana. A cuvee based on the 2014 vintage that was disgorged 10 years later. Drink or hold."
